Document
拖动滑块完成拼图
个人中心

预订订单
服务订单
发布专利 发布成果 人才入驻 发布商标 发布需求

在线咨询

联系我们

龙图腾公众号
首页 专利交易 科技果 科技人才 科技服务 国际服务 商标交易 会员权益 IP管家助手 需求市场 关于龙图腾
 /  免费注册
到顶部 到底部
清空 搜索
当前位置 : 首页 > 专利喜报 > 恭喜西安热工研究院有限公司李晓博获国家专利权

恭喜西安热工研究院有限公司李晓博获国家专利权

买专利卖专利找龙图腾,真高效! 查专利查商标用IPTOP,全免费!专利年费监控用IP管家,真方便!

龙图腾网恭喜西安热工研究院有限公司申请的专利一种基于双缓冲区的分布式控制器数据库下装结构及方法获国家发明授权专利权,本发明授权专利权由国家知识产权局授予,授权公告号为:CN111948998B

龙图腾网通过国家知识产权局官网在2025-05-06发布的发明授权授权公告中获悉:该发明授权的专利申请号/专利号为:202010939543.5,技术领域涉及:G05B19/418;该发明授权一种基于双缓冲区的分布式控制器数据库下装结构及方法是由李晓博;高海东;高少华;王宾;马乐;崔逸群;高龙军设计研发完成,并于2020-09-08向国家知识产权局提交的专利申请。

一种基于双缓冲区的分布式控制器数据库下装结构及方法在说明书摘要公布了:本发明提供的一种基于双缓冲区的分布式控制器数据库下装结构及方法,包括核心交换机,核心交换机通过以太网分别连接有控制层接入交换机和应用层接入交换机,控制层接入交换机通过以太网连接有控制器;应用层接入交换机通过以太网连接有至少一个工程师站;其中,工程师站用于编译生产数据库文件,并通过应用层接入交换机将生成的数据库文件下装到控制器;该系统连接结构简单,安装和施工方便;采用了双缓冲区设计,很好的支持了数据库在线下装操作,初始下装和在线下装采用了统一的文件格式,使得控制系统在线下装数据库操作简单可行。

本发明授权一种基于双缓冲区的分布式控制器数据库下装结构及方法在权利要求书中公布了:1.一种基于双缓冲区的分布式控制器数据库下装方法,其特征在于,基于一种基于双缓冲区的分布式控制器数据库下装结构,该结构包括核心交换机S1,核心交换机S1分别连接有控制层接入交换机S2和应用层接入交换机S3,控制层接入交换机S2连接有过程控制站;应用层接入交换机S3连接有至少一个工程师站;其中,工程师站用于编译生产数据库文件,并通过应用层接入交换机S3将生成的数据库文件下装到过程控制站;包括以下步骤:步骤1,对过程控制站中的参数进行自定义,其中,设定下装标志为Flag1,当Flag1=0时,表示控制器处于初始状态,且执行的是数据库初始下装;当Flag1=1时表示控制器处于在线运行状态,且执行的是数据库在线下装;设定切换标志为Flag2,当Flag2=0时,表示不需要执行数据库切换操作,当Flag2=1时,表示需要执行数据库切换操作;步骤2,对过程控制站进行初始化上电,之后对过程控制站进行分区处理,且将核心交换机S1赋值为0,完成后过程控制站以设定的广播周期将下装标志Flag1发送给工程师站;步骤3,工程师站实时接收来下装标志Flag1,并判断Flag1的值,接着工程师站将编译生成的数据库文件发送到过程控制站;步骤4,过程控制站通过下装操作装载该数据库文件,进而建立过程控制站运行的实时数据库;步骤4中,下装操作包括初始下装和在线下装,其中,当Flag1=0时,下装操作为初始下装;当Flag1=1时,下装操作为在线下装;初始下装的具体方法是:控制器将接收到的数据库文件分别写入第一数据库区DB1和第二数据库区DB2,并且分别从第一数据库区DB1和第二数据库区DB2的起始地址开始,按照字节顺序依次写入数据库文件,然后给Pa赋值1,表示当前活动的数据库为第一数据库区DB1,同时给Flag1赋值1,表示初始下装完成;在线下装的具体方法是:对Pa的值进行判断:当Pa=1时,表示当前工作的数据库是第一数据库区DB1,控制器将接收到数据库文件写入到第二数据库区DB2;然后,当数据库文件写入完成后,工程师站向控制器发送命令,将切换标志Flag2赋值为1;控制器在每个运算周期的运算任务执行完成后,判断切换标志Flag2的赋值,当Flag2=1,表示切换,控制器赋值Pa=2,表示下个运算周期控制器将自动使用第二数据库区DB2进行计算;当Flag2=0时,表示不切换,下个运算周期控制器继续使用第一数据库区DB1进行计算;当Pa=2时,表示当前工作的是第二数据库区DB2,工控制器将接收到的数据库文件写入到第一数据库区DB1;然后,当数据库文件写入完成后,工程师站向控制器发送命令,将切换标志Flag2赋值为1;当Flag2=1,表示切换,控制器执行切换操作;控制器赋值Pa=1,表示下个运算周期控制器将自动使用第一数据库区DB1进行计算;当Flag2=0时,表示不切换,下个运算周期控制器继续使用第二数据库区DB2进行计算。

如需购买、转让、实施、许可或投资类似专利技术,可联系本专利的申请人或专利权人西安热工研究院有限公司,其通讯地址为:710048 陕西省西安市碑林区兴庆路136号;或者联系龙图腾网官方客服,联系龙图腾网可拨打电话0551-65771310或微信搜索“龙图腾网”。

免责声明
1、本报告根据公开、合法渠道获得相关数据和信息,力求客观、公正,但并不保证数据的最终完整性和准确性。
2、报告中的分析和结论仅反映本公司于发布本报告当日的职业理解,仅供参考使用,不能作为本公司承担任何法律责任的依据或者凭证。